Understanding Modern Noise Monitoring Technology
Today's intelligent noise monitoring systems go far beyond simple decibel meters. They utilize sophisticated algorithms that can differentiate between various types of sounds, distinguishing between normal ambient noise and potentially disruptive activities. This technology represents a significant leap forward from basic noise detection devices that often triggered false alarms.
Sound Pattern Recognition Capabilities
Modern systems can identify specific sound signatures that commonly lead to guest complaints:
- Party-related noise: Loud music, multiple voices, and rhythmic sounds
- Impact sounds: Footsteps, door slamming, and furniture movement
- Extended conversations: Prolonged loud talking in hallways or outdoor areas
- Mechanical disturbances: HVAC issues, plumbing problems, or equipment malfunctions
The key advantage of pattern recognition is its ability to provide context. Rather than simply measuring volume levels, these systems analyze sound characteristics to determine whether intervention is necessary. For instance, the system might detect elevated decibel levels during daytime hours but recognize them as normal housekeeping activities, while flagging the same levels during quiet hours as potential disturbances.

Implementing Automated Incident Logging
One of the most valuable features of intelligent noise monitoring is its ability to automatically document incidents with precise timestamps, duration, and sound level data. This automated logging serves multiple critical functions in hospitality operations.
Creating Comprehensive Incident Records
Every detected disturbance generates a detailed log entry that includes:
- Exact time and duration of the incident
- Peak and average decibel levels
- Sound pattern classification
- Affected room numbers and guest information
- Weather conditions and occupancy rates
- Staff response times and actions taken
This level of documentation proves invaluable when analyzing noise patterns and identifying recurring issues. For example, you might discover that complaints spike on weekends in specific room clusters, indicating a need for targeted preventive measures or revised room assignment strategies.
Building a Data-Driven Noise Management Strategy
The accumulated data from automated logging enables property managers to make informed decisions about noise policies, room pricing, and guest communications. Properties using comprehensive logging report a 40% improvement in their ability to predict and prevent noise-related incidents within the first six months of implementation.
Consider the case of a boutique hotel that discovered through automated logging that 80% of their noise complaints originated from rooms adjacent to the elevator shaft during late evening hours. This insight led to strategic room reassignments for noise-sensitive guests and the installation of additional sound dampening materials, reducing complaints by 65%.
Designing Proactive Staff Alert Systems
The true power of intelligent noise monitoring lies in its ability to alert staff before situations escalate into formal complaints. Effective alert systems are carefully calibrated to provide actionable information without overwhelming staff with false alarms.
Tiered Alert Protocols
Successful implementations typically use a three-tier alert system:
Level 1 - Awareness Alerts: Notification of elevated noise levels that warrant monitoring but don't require immediate action. These alerts help staff stay informed about developing situations.
Level 2 - Action Required: Situations where noise levels or patterns indicate likely guest impact. Staff receive detailed information about the location, nature of the disturbance, and suggested response protocols.
Level 3 - Urgent Response: Severe disturbances that require immediate intervention. These alerts trigger multiple staff notifications and may automatically escalate to management if not acknowledged within a specified timeframe.
Mobile Integration and Response Tracking
Modern alert systems integrate with mobile devices, allowing staff to receive notifications wherever they are on the property. The most effective systems include response tracking features that monitor how quickly alerts are acknowledged and resolved, providing valuable data for staff performance evaluation and system optimization.
Properties report that mobile-integrated alert systems reduce average response times by 60% compared to traditional communication methods, significantly improving guest satisfaction outcomes.
Best Practices for System Deployment
Successful deployment of intelligent noise monitoring requires careful planning and attention to both technical and operational considerations. The following best practices have been developed from real-world implementations across various property types.
Strategic Sensor Placement
Sensor location is crucial for system effectiveness. Focus on high-risk areas while maintaining guest privacy:
- Common areas: Lobbies, hallways, poolside areas, and event spaces
- Adjacent spaces: Areas near guest rooms where disturbances commonly originate
- Outdoor areas: Patios, balconies, and garden areas where noise travels to guest rooms
- Mechanical areas: Equipment rooms and service areas where operational noise might affect guests
Avoid placing sensors inside guest rooms to maintain privacy and comply with local regulations. External monitoring of common areas and adjacent spaces provides sufficient coverage for most noise issues.
Staff Training and Change Management
Technology is only as effective as the people using it. Comprehensive staff training should cover:
- Understanding alert classifications and appropriate responses
- Guest communication techniques for noise-related interventions
- Documentation requirements and incident reporting procedures
- System maintenance and basic troubleshooting
Successful properties often designate "noise monitoring champions" among their staff who receive advanced training and serve as internal resources for system-related questions.
Guest Communication Strategies
When staff must address potential noise issues, the approach is critical. Develop standardized communication protocols that:
- Emphasize concern for all guests' comfort rather than accusations
- Provide specific information about noise policies and quiet hours
- Offer solutions or alternatives when possible
- Document interactions for follow-up and trend analysis
Measuring Success and ROI
The effectiveness of intelligent noise monitoring systems can be measured through multiple metrics that directly impact your property's bottom line and reputation.
Key Performance Indicators
Track these essential metrics to evaluate system performance:
- Complaint Reduction Rate: Percentage decrease in formal noise complaints
- Response Time Improvement: Average time from incident detection to staff response
- Guest Satisfaction Scores: Changes in overall satisfaction and noise-related feedback
- Operational Efficiency: Staff time saved through proactive vs. reactive approaches
- Revenue Impact: Reduced refunds, compensation costs, and negative review mitigation
Return on Investment Calculations
Properties typically see positive ROI within 8-12 months of implementation. Consider both direct savings (reduced complaint resolution costs, fewer refunds) and indirect benefits (improved online reviews, increased repeat bookings, enhanced staff efficiency).
A mid-size hotel chain reported that after implementing intelligent noise monitoring across five properties, they achieved a 45% reduction in noise complaints and saved an estimated $18,000 annually per property in direct complaint resolution costs alone.
